A recent Wallet Hub survey found that 87% of small business owners say their business is hurting from the coronavirus outbreak. Even more alarming is this stat, 35% of small business owners saying their business cannot survive more than 3 months in current conditions.

That being said, a new study just released by Wallet Hub shows the states with the most affected small businesses. Iowa comes in at #31. To identify the states in which businesses are hit hardest by COVID-19, WalletHub compared the 50 states and the District of Columbia across 12 key metrics. The data set looks at...share of small businesses operating in highly affected industries...to small-business credit conditions...the state’s small-business "friendliness" and much more.
